Cutting the Acrylic Blank |
|
The acrylic blank is cut roughly square on the bandsaw. |
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
Drilling the acrylic blank |
|
A 15/32" barrel is drilled into the blank on the drill press |
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
Prepping the brass barrel |
|
The brass barrel insert is scored before being glued into the blank. |
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
Rough sharpening the roughing gouge |
|
A nice unhoned 50-degree angle is set into the 1" roughing gouge. |
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
Roughing out the blank |
|
The gouge is used to round the blank and knock off the corners created by the squaring bit. |

Sanding the blank |
|
Progressive grits (120, 160, 220, 320, 400, 600, 800, 1000 and 2000) bring the blank to a high gloss. A coating of carnuba will complete the finish. |
